Sale Overview

Our upcoming European Art auction, including Orientalist Art in London features a curated range of works form the heart of 19th-century Europe. Highlights of Nordic art include a sensational work by Finnish artist Akseli Gallen-Kallela. A range of exemplary French Barbizon inspired plein-air works from Corot to Rousseau take the first steps on the path towards Impressionism. A selection of Dutch romantic paintings, sitting alongside Spanish depictions of the modern garden by artists such as Santiago Rusiñol, is also featured. There is a strong offering of Orientalist works, ranging from Jean Leon Gerome’s precise and delicate style, to topographically accurate renditions of Istanbul by Malta’s Count Amadeo Preziosi.
